Diagnosing Common Mini Split Line Set Concerns
Installing a mini split system can seem straightforward, but encountering issues with the line set is common. These flexible copper tubes carry refrigerant between the indoor and outdoor units, and even small mistakes during installation can lead to major problems. Frequent causes include kinks in the line set which restrict airflow or improper flaring at the connections, resulting in leaks. If your system isn't cooling as expected, it could be a sign of a line set issue. A technician can inspect these problems and make the necessary repairs to get your mini split running efficiently again.
- Primary check for any visible damage or bends in the line set.
- Inspect the connections to make sure they are securely fastened and free of leaks.
- Confirm that the insulation is properly installed to prevent condensation.
Augment Your Line Set for Maximum AC Coverage

Properly situating your line set is crucial for ensuring optimal cooling performance. If your existing line set doesn't adequately reach all areas you want to climate-control, augmenting it can be a simple and effective solution.
First, carefully assess the distance between your compressor unit and the farthest point requiring AC service. This will help you determine the required length of copper tubing needed for your extended line set.
Always refer to your manufacturer's specifications regarding line set expansion. They often provide specific instructions and restrictions to ensure a safe and effective installation.
It's also important to factor in the potential effect of extending your line set on system efficiency. Longer lines can lead to increased inertia, which may slightly reduce cooling capacity.
When lengthening your line set, remember to maintain proper pressure levels and use certified technicians for the installation process.
